Worship at Niantic Community Church
Worship each Sunday at NCC is a joyous celebration of God's love.
We believe in sharing God's love through singing, praying, and hearing the Good News of the
Gospel. We include time to share news of ministries in the church community (casually known as
"announcements"), and our prayers focus on concerns and joys of the congregation.
Because worship is a celebration for the entire family, the "Thought for Young Minds" is an
important element of the worship service, when younger children gather sit the pastor to hear
a story just for them. Lay participation, a variety of styles of vocal and instrumental music, and
occasional special performances compliment the Celebration of Worship.
Child care for infants through Kindergarten is provided during worship by volunteers from the congregation.
The Sacrament of Communion is served on the first Sunday of every month, and all are invited to participate.

Scripture Readings
Our church generally follows a three-year cycle of scripture readings (or "Lectionary")
on Sunday mornings. We encourage you to read the passages ahead of time,
for your own reflection. Many worshippers find this practice helps them to enrich their
experience.
